Use that file at your own risk.*//* This file is used as additional startup file when linking programs for DJGPP. This is needed if you want to have full exception support. It needs some assistance by the linker script and assumes that in the linker script the symbol ___EH_FRAME_BEGIN__ is defined and that this symbol is defined as the first symbol in the .eh_frame section (shortened to the .eh_fram section). To explain it, here a snipped from a linker script, how it could be written: .data ALIGN(0x200) : { djgpp_first_ctor = . ; LONG(_init_frame) ; *(.ctor) djgpp_last_ctor = . ; djgpp_first_dtor = . ; *(.dtor) djgpp_last_dtor = . ; *(.data) *(.gcc_exc) ___EH_FRAME_BEGIN__ = . ; *(.eh_fram) ___EH_FRAME_END__ = . ; LONG(0) edata = . ; _edata = .; . = ALIGN(0x200); } As the next it assumes, that this file is placed as the first (or the second after crt0.o) object file in each executable via the specs file so it can be sure, that the function with the constructor attribute is called first before any other constructors. As an example, here a sample entry, how the specs file could be written:*startfile:%{pg:gcrt0.o%s}%{!pg:%{p:mcrt0.o%s}%{!p:crtf.o crt0.o%s}} */ extern void __EH_FRAME_BEGIN__();/* This function is provided with the libgcc.a library which simply registers the start of the exception tables by remembering the address passed with the first argument and initializing a struct passed with the second argument. */extern void __register_frame_info (void *, void *);static void __attribute__((constructor))frame_dummy (){ /* normally this should be a struct object { void *pc_begin; void *pc_end; void *fde_begin; void **fde_array; size_t count; struct object *next; }; but a placeholder of the same size does it also */ /* W A R N I N G : If the size of this struct changes in future versions of gcc, remember this here !!! The struct is declared in the file frame.h from the gcc sources */ static int object[6]; __register_frame_info (__EH_FRAME_BEGIN__, &object);}
